Output 8b5df79b4719ab517a9efbddd369476f1e12afda7e69e6693f4a67f11c56139a:1

value
545392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52649708968356a306ec69243088e4934622816b OP_EQUAL
address
39CfqPStoQ13ciaS4SpDNbwuXnMka19Uc5
transaction
8b5df79b4719ab517a9efbddd369476f1e12afda7e69e6693f4a67f11c56139a
spent
true